I just acquired this boat and have had to make adjustments to the winch stand to get placement correct. I think it's looking pretty good, but need help with safety chain. There is no current attachment point for the safety chain so I need some help determining where, how, and what hardware is needed. Thanks in advance!

Here is the current configuration:

Ayuh,..... Welcome Aboard,...... a simple way to go would be to use abit longer bolt holding the winch, 'n put a length of chain on the bottom of it, 'n a hook to slip onto the bow eye,....
You'd need a longer bolt, 2 nuts, the chain, 'n the hook,.....

Thanks! Would that be strong enough for 3500 lb boat? I'm currently using grade 8 bolts so i'd replace the bolt with one an inch or two longer, place the washer and nut where they currently are to lock in the winch, then with the remaining length put a washer, chain link, another washer, and then another nut?

Ayuh,...... Plenty of strength in that installation,....

You've already got the winch strap, 'n the ratchet strap,..... you don't need a logging chain on there,..... ;)
